Bug 1316527 - Return 0 when GetSerialNumber fails to find an existing serial number. r=froydnj

NS_LogCOMPtrAddRef and NS_LogCOMPtrRelease always pass false to
GetSerialNumber, because they pass in everything they get without
regard to whether it is being logged or not, so they don't want to
create a serial number if none exists. This causes the assertions
added in bug 1309051 to be hit. To work around this, I hoist the
assertion into the other callers of this method. Two of them already
had this check, but it was non-fatal.

This also makes the asserts not happen in release builds, as I decided
it doesn't really matter what happens if somebody tries to use it
there.
